How did Americans in the bottom half of the income ladder fare in the 1990s?
What will be an ideal response?
The ideal answer should include:
1. In the 1990s, the bottom 60 percent of the population saw their real income decline, even as the economy boomed.
2. The top 1 percent of Americans owned more wealth than the bottom 90 percent combined.
3. Middle-class black families had fewer assets and resources, making their hold on middle-class status more precarious than that of their white peers.
4. The rate of unemployment was more than twice as high for blacks as for whites.
5. Recent immigrants from Asia, Africa, and Latin America joined African Americans in jobs at the bottom of the economy.
6. Workers at the bottom of the labor force gained little or nothing from the economic boom of the 1990s.
